Definition
SafeControl

The safe set C\mathcal{C} is the Level Set of a smooth function h:DβŠ‚Rnβ†’Rh:D\subset\mathbb{R}^{n}\to \mathbb{R}, such that C={x∈DβŠ‚Rn:h(x)β‰₯0}βˆ‚C={x∈DβŠ‚Rn:h(x)=0}Int(C)={x∈DβŠ‚Rn:h(x)>0} \begin{align*}\\ \mathcal{C}&= \{ x\in D\subset\mathbb{R}^{n}:h(x)\ge 0 \}\\ \partial \mathcal{C}&= \{ x\in D\subset \mathbb{R}^{n}:h(x)=0 \}\\ \text{Int}(\mathcal{C})&= \{ x\in D\subset \mathbb{R}^{n}:h(x)>0 \} \end{align*}where βˆ€x∈Rn\forall x\in \mathbb{R}^{n} s.t. h(x)=0h(x)=0 we have that βˆ‚hβˆ‚x(x)=ΜΈ0.\frac{ \partial h }{ \partial x } (x)\not=0.
